Hi My HP Stream 11 will not connect to wifi no matter what I try. I have installed a fresh copy of windows 10 and this has also failed to rectify the issue. The network appears in the list but when I try to connect it simply says "unable to connect to this network" I saw in a previous post that deleting the wifi drivers and reinstalling them may work and this can be done via ethernet. Problem is the stream 11 doesn't have an ethernet connection. And can't use the wifi obviously. Any idea's? Or is the thing a useless pile of junk? I have another HP laptop and that has the same issue although it does have an ethernet connection. We have other devices in the house and they all connect to the wifi. Speedtest reveals 25mbps so should be fine.

Hi:
What model wifi adapter does your notebook have?
If you don't know, go to the device manager, click to expand the network adapters device manager category and there you will find the name and model number of the wireless network adapter.
You can download any drivers you need from another PC, copy them to a USB flash drive, plug the flash drive into your notebook's USB port and install them from there.
